Welcome aboard! RateLens is our rate-parity checker for the Harborview hotel group. It scrapes partner channels nightly, normalizes currencies, and flags rooms priced below contract floor. Most of your work will be in the normalizer — it's cranky about taxes and fees, so read the edge-case notes before touching it. Local setup takes about an hour. Start with the environment guide on the internal page below.

wiki page, fahaf-yagag: https://confluence.qorvellabs.internal/pages/display/pages/display

## Formula sandbox tuning

User-supplied formulas in Gridmoor execute inside a restricted interpreter with hard ceilings on time, memory, and call depth. Reviewers should confirm any change to these ceilings is justified in the PR description, since raising them widens the abuse surface. Defaults were chosen from production traces. The current limits are as follows.

limits module of tafog-fawip:
WEIGHTS = {
    "julix": 57,
    "lamys": 992,
    "kasvan": 209,
    "quenok": 750,
    "alddor": 259,
    "oliath": 1009,
    "wenix": 815,
}

**Key Ceremony Checklist — Item 12 (Digest Scheduler Keys)**

For the weekly eng sync: confirm the Mailbarrow digest scheduler has drained its batch queue before rotating its signing keys. The scheduler fires hourly digests at :05 and daily digests at 06:00 local, so schedule the ceremony in the gap between runs to avoid half-signed batches. Verify the pause flag is set, confirm zero in-flight jobs in the dashboard, and record the witness names in the ceremony log. To unlock the key escrow drawer, use the recovery passphrase noted below.

unlock words, tawif-tahop: oliys-ulawyn-tamdor-lamys-casox-jormir-fraius-kasath-ulador-ulamir-holir-sorys-holeth

**Q: The Quillfeed markdown pipeline stopped rendering and I'm locked out of the admin panel. Now what?**

A: This happens when the renderer worker crashes mid-rotation. Restart the worker, then open the recovery prompt from the pipeline dashboard. It will ask you to confirm your shift before accepting the recovery passphrase listed below.

strongbox words: sorir-belvan-rusix-ulays-ralmir-praix-eliir-tamax-praael-druael-julir-tamius-jorir